Hughesnet router admin login. If your Hughesnet internet isn’t working, you first need to power cycle your modem and router. To do that, unplug the modem and router (or a modem/router combo, sometimes called a gateway) for at least five minutes. Then, replug the devices and wait two minutes while the network resets. This should clear up the most common Hughesnet …

When you log in you're logging into the router's wifi settings and should be using the admin password for it - that's not the same as the password to access the wifi on your device. Unless it's been set by someone, I believe the default admin password for the router is simply 'admin' (no quotes). Go to the router’s administrative console in a browser. Enter the default password when prompted. Look for a password setting or similar field. Enter a new password and save it. Dec 27, 2017 · For the password on the two regular radios, change the Password for the 2.4GHz radio, then click Save Settings, then do the same for the 5GHz radio. Just don't lose the newly created password(s), of course. Also, you can use the same password for both radios (like it is by default), or you can use a different password for each. It's up to you. Press Enter after entering the IP address.To view your devices, login to your myhughesnet.com account and visit ‘Usage’ > ‘Wi-Fi management’ page. On this page you can view the devices connected to the LAN, and the different Wi-Fi channels. Only the devices connected to your Hughesnet modem will be displayed.
